The strength and extensibility of a noncrystallizable elastomer depend on its viscoelastic properties (28,29), even when the stress remains in equilibrium with the strain until macroscopic fracture occurs. In theory, such elastomers have a time- or rate-independent strength and ultimate elongation, but such threshold quantities apparently have not been measured, though rough estimates have been made (28,30). [Pg.431]

In addition to conferring transparency on these polymers, the amorphous noncrystallizable nature of polysulfones assures minimal shrinkage during fabrication of the resins into finished parts. The absence of crystallinity also assures dimensional stability during the service life of the parts where high use temperatures are encountered. Good dimensional stability is important to many structural and engineering applications. [Pg.464]

Polymerization of nonsymmetrical cyclic molecules gives stereochemi-cally variable polymers, [-SiRR 0-] , analogous to the totally organic vinyl and vinylidene polymers [-CRR CH2-] . In principle, these polymers can be prepared in the same stereoregular forms (isotactic and syndiotactic) that have been achieved for some of their organic counterparts 1, 17). Unfortunately, the stereoregular forms have not been prepared, and only the stereoirregular form (atactic) has been obtained. Unlike the other two stereochemical forms, the atactic form is inherently noncrystallizable. [Pg.48]

Although fully amorphous polymers cannot be achieved by quenching, it is possible to obtain polyesters with different degrees of crytallinity by copolymerization with a noncrystallizable diol. For example, the polyester of 1,6-hexanediol condensed with adipic acid is about 60% crystalline, while the polyester of this diacid with 2,5-hexanediol is completely amorphous.
